I got a fancy e-mail from Garmin today with a special discount code to "buy" my new Vector 3 battery doors. Each door is normally $30 each (which is insane), but with the code, the $60 purchase was free. It says I'll get them in about 3 to 4 weeks.

In the e-mail was also info on two other major issues they are having with Vector 3's. One is a loose spindle bolt, which you can fix yourself by taking the whole pedal apart, and the second issue is a separated pedal body and this error requires calling Garmin for servicing.


I received this same email this morning and was not aware of the loose spindle issue - I wonder if that is for the really early models as I did not experience this issue. I didn't see anything about the pedal body separating (unless they are referring to after the spindle becomes loose and then it separates).

I am going to tear mine apart tonight to verify if the hub/shaft is loose.
